TUT Women’s football team ranked top10 in Africa

11 March 2022

The Tshwane University of Technology (TUT) Women’s Football team is recognised as one of the best ten female clubs in Africa. This is according to the latest 2022 International Federation of Football History and Statistics (IFFHS) rankings. 

The IFFHS ranking is based on the performance of clubs in international and national tournaments over the last 12 months. The calculation system is similar to the IFFHS Men’s Club World ranking whose points in national tournaments are calculated depending on the level of a national league.

Dr Shadrack Nthangeni, Acting Executive Director of SAED said these rankings represent a significant step forward on how we are viewed across the world, our performance and more notably, our influence and contribution to the sporting fraternity. We are ranked number 9 and we are the only University of Technology (UOT) on the list. Indeed, we are extremely proud of the ladies’ team, who work tirelessly to elevate the university stature in the country, the continent and world.

In addition, Dr Nthangeni said the entire university community ought to celebrate the remarkable milestone. “Indeed, this achievement is the result of efforts from our couches, sport administrators and the whole TUT community”.
